Age and Task Degree Considerations



As your puppy ages, their energy levels and activity needs can change considerably, which can affect their day care experience.

Youthful, energised pet dogs often grow in daycare setups, taking advantage of the socializing and playtime. However, as your canine develops, they might choose calmer settings or shorter gos to.

Elderly pets might require unique factors to consider, like much less strenuous activities and even more breaks. Observe your canine's actions and power levels to identify the ideal day care regularity.

If they appear tired or nervous after a day at day care, it may be time to downsize. On the other side, if your older pet dog stays energetic and involved, they can still enjoy normal daycare sees.

Customizing their routine guarantees a positive experience for both of you.

Breed-Specific Behaviors



Comprehending breed-specific habits is necessary for picking the appropriate daycare for your puppy. Different breeds have unique characteristics that affect their needs and communications.

As an example, rounding up breeds like Boundary Collies may grow in environments that allow for activity and mental excitement, while toy breeds like Chihuahuas might prefer a quieter room. Knowing your pet dog's breed can aid you select a day care that matches their power levels and social dynamics.

For example, high-energy breeds may require more playtime and organized activities, while extra laid-back types may appreciate kicked back relaxing. By thinking about these behaviors, you can ensure your pet has a positive experience, making it simpler for them to adjust and appreciate their time away from home.

Indicators Your Dog Needs daycare



Identifying when your canine needs daycare can dramatically improve their health and joy. One indication is too much boredom in your home; if your puppy's been chewing furniture or digging, it's time for even more stimulation.

Expect signs of anxiety or restlessness, like pacing or whining. If your pet dog seems extremely reluctant or responsive around various other pets, daycare can help with socializing.

You could likewise discover they're a lot more energised after playdates; if they're eager to engage with others, daycare offers that opportunity.

Finally, if you're working long hours, your canine might really feel lonely. Routine daycare can use companionship, exercise, and mental difficulties, ensuring they remain pleased and healthy and balanced while you're active.

Establishing a Daycare Set Up



Establishing a daycare timetable for your canine is important to ensure they get the correct amount of social communication and mental stimulation.

Begin by evaluating your pet's energy degrees and individuality. If they're extremely energetic, consider more regular sees, probably two to three times a week. For calmer pet dogs, once a week might be adequate.

Take note of your pet's responses after day care; if they're overly worn out or stressed out, adjust the regularity. Consistency is crucial, so stick to the same days and times to assist your dog really feel secure.

Additionally, keep an eye on any type of changes in behavior or health and wellness, and talk to your vet if you have issues. Tailoring the timetable to your pet dog's requirements will certainly cultivate their happiness and well-being.

Alternatives to Canine day care



If you're trying to find options to pet daycare, there are numerous alternatives that can give your hairy close friend with the social communication and stimulation they need.

Consider hiring a dog pedestrian or pet sitter who can take your dog on day-to-day journeys. This not only provides exercise however additionally exposes them to new atmospheres.

You might likewise discover pet playdates with close friends or neighbors that've friendly pet dogs; regular interaction with other canines can be advantageous.

Furthermore, enrolling in obedience or agility classes can supply psychological excitement and social opportunities.

Last but not least, providing appealing playthings or puzzles in your home can keep your dog amused and emotionally sharp while you're busy.

These choices can create a satisfying regimen for your pet.
